Transaction 2395e62008b1cca61b45d5df6995dd924214171f41c71adc41051e81638a4b1e
1 Input
1 Output
-
2395e62008b1cca61b45d5df6995dd924214171f41c71adc41051e81638a4b1e:0
- value
- 978706
- script pubkey
- OP_0 OP_PUSHBYTES_20 35df6f2ec08fc2886a678b4922ae1a74cb9891ca
- address
- bc1qxh0k7tkq3lpgs6n83dyj9ts6wn9e3yw2fs6q3z